Marvin, There are two (at least) possibilities. The float could now be too low for high speed operation or the high speed jet may need some adjustment. I had a similar problem on my M and fixed it with the high speed adjustment. Get a manual, an I&T form the local farm store should do, and try the adjustment first. Then if that doesen't work, adjust the float a little at a time until the problem goes away. Running for a long time with a lean condition will burn the valves, so don't wait very long to fix this.
